Oregon took a 31-0 lead into the half at the Alamo Bowl against TCU which wasn’t enough in the end.

The Horned Frogs ended up scoring 31 unanswered in the second half before completing the comeback in three OTs defeating Oregon 47-41.

The win for TCU ended up being the largest comeback in a bowl game since the 2006 Insight Bowl when Texas Tech overcame a 38-7 margin against Minnesota.

All this was done too with TCU going with Bram Kohlhousen quarterback over the recently suspended Trevor Boykin.
